Search anything with everything

File indexing by default is extremely slow on Windows, and always has been. This is why searching for files in Explorer can take so long. On occasion, I have manually located a file faster than searching in Explorer. That’s why I switched to Everything.

The entire search window is running.

Everything is an incredibly lightweight and fast search engine. Think of it like Spotlight, except for Windows. It can instantly extract any file or folder on your computer. You can refine your search with filters to match file names or formats. There is even an advanced search functionality.

File options in Everything Search.

Every time you update or add a file, Everything indexes it immediately. It creates its database within seconds of the first installation and searches for changes in real time. It’s so fast that you don’t even need to complete the query to retrieve a file or folder. It extracts files as you type. No progress bar.

You can even search network folders. Just press the shortcut key (Ctrl+N by default) and start typing.

It takes very few resources to run Everything and it’s completely free. If you have a lot of files on your computer, Everything is essential.

Work faster with PowerToys

The Microsoft app that Microsoft doesn’t tell anyone about

PowerToys is not integrated with Windows, but it is an official Microsoft product. It is a set of utilities designed to improve workflows in Windows. It is installed as a single program and gives you access to a whole library of incredibly useful tools. Let’s take a look at a few of these utilities (there are many more).

If you ever want to pin a window or app on top of everything else, PowerToys lets you do it with a quick shortcut. How about custom window tiling? You can create custom layouts to divide the screen into custom zones using FancyZones.

Preview panes in Windows display the contents of a file without opening it. Unfortunately, this is mostly limited to image previews. With PowerToys, you can preview over 150 file types, including PDFs, source code files, markdowns, and more. If your workflow involves switching between files often, PowerToys can save you time.

Have you ever encountered the error “you cannot delete this file because it is in use by another process?” » You must manually scroll through the list of active processes in Task Manager to find which program is using the file you are trying to modify or delete. This may take time and may not always work. Let the PowerToys File Locksmith utility automatically find and terminate this program for you.

Rename files in bulk with PowerRename. Use the color picker anywhere on your screen or in any app with a keyboard shortcut. Create custom shortcuts. Paste text in any format using Advanced Paste. Resize images on the fly with Image Resizer (launched from right-click context menu). Or instantly launch apps with PowerToys Run. Just press Alt+Space and type the app name (it only indexes apps).

PowerToys is a must-have for experienced users. Plus, it’s free and lightweight.

Clean up messy folders with File Juggler

Automate file organization

Instead of organizing files manually and regularly, you can automate the entire process. With File Juggler, you can set rules to automatically move files into folders. It can also automatically rename, delete and copy files to folders. This way, you won’t have to deal with ever-increasing clutter on your computer.

File Juggler can also read the contents of documents to automatically name them and move them to where they belong based on their contents. It will monitor new documents and organize them as well.

You only need to configure it once. After that, File Juggler will handle all incoming files.

Faster file browsing with Explorer++

Smarter, more customizable file browsing

I love a browser-style bookmarks bar in my File Explorer; This is one of my favorite things about Explorer++. This allows me to quickly favorite locations and access them quickly. I know that pinned folders exist in Windows Explorer, but they are mixed in with the rest of the file tree. A sleek bookmark stands out, and it’s just more practical.

Many alternative file explorers have a bookmarks manager, but I use Explorer++. It has tabbed browsing and a robust bookmarks manager. You can add a directory to your favorites with Ctrl+D as you would in a browser. It then appears on the dedicated bookmarks bar at the top.

Explorer++ also has a few other great options. Consider its “Destroy File” feature. Even after emptying the Trash, your deleted files are not really erased: they can be recovered using data recovery tools. In Explorer++, you can permanently delete files using the “Destory File” button. You can also split or merge files.

Explorer++ is free and lightweight software. Its user interface is also customizable, so you can tailor it to your particular workflow.

Delete files securely with Eraser

Actually delete what you delete

When you delete a file in Windows, it is not the file that is deleted but its index. Think of the index as the table of contents of a book. Even if you delete a chapter from the index, the actual pages of the chapter remain in the book.

Once the reference disappears, the file can possibly be replaced by another one because it is marked as available. However, before it gets overwritten, it is quite easy to restore it. So, if you actually want to erase a file from your hard drive, it must be overwritten. This is what Eraser does.

Eraser is a free utility that deletes files by overwriting them several times. Once you delete a file like this, it is impossible to recover it. In fact, it’s so effective that the U.S. government recommends it for wiping down appliances.

You can delete a file with Eraser from the right-click context menu. However, this may take a little longer than a normal deletion (especially for larger files). You can download Eraser from the official website.
